Industrial hemp is from the Cannabis sativa plant species and has been used to globally manufacture a range of industrial and consumer products. While all three products contain tetrahydrocannabinol (THC), a compound that causes psychoactive effects in humans, the variety of cannabis grown for cannabis has only small THC amounts compared to that developed for the manufacture of marijuana or hashish. The hemp used to be one of the most common crops globally, even though the government encouraged farmers to grow it in the USA. In 1942, a film titled “Hemp for Victory” was released by the US government, discussing the various uses of the plant and encouraging the agricultural sector of the nation to cultivate as much of it as they could as part of the war efforts. The plant is easy to operate and used in several applications, including animal bedding, stock fodder, fiberboard, ropes and cordage, bio-plastics, concrete (hempcrete) type, clothing and textiles, insulation, bio-plastics, cooking oil, biofuel, food for human consumption, water filters. Another very relevant cosmetics and skincare, hemp use, is a cannabinoid called cannabidiol (CBD). At the same time, only true hemp is produced by the hemp plant. These include Indian hemp, Mauritius hemp, and sunn hemp. Hemp has been an important crop for food, fiber, and medicine throughout human history.

MARKET DRIVERS:

Increased use of hemp-based products is related to the growth of this market due to their numerous health benefits and increased incidences of diseases such as epilepsy and other sleep disorders. Increased legalization of industrial hemp cultivation in many countries generated greater awareness of the benefits of industrial hemp and growing use of industrial hemp in various industries such as textiles, pharmaceuticals, food, beverage, personal care, construction & materials, furniture, and paper is expected to drive the industrial hemp market. Hemp is a source of fiber and oilseed cultivated in over 30 nations. The output is limited in the United States under drug enforcement laws. The manufacturer must receive a permit from the Drug Enforcement Agency to cultivate industrial hemp in the U.S. (DEA). Growing demand for hemp oil and fibers in the automotive, construction, food and beverage, personal care, and textile industries drives the market, especially in emerging regions such as the Asia Pacific. The United States is the largest importer of hemp products, with the bulk of its seed and fiber being sourced from Canada and China.

Additionally, innovations in studying cannabis genetics by draft genome papers, transcriptome sequencing, quantitative trait mapping, and genetic comparisons between hemp and marijuana have been seen in recent years. Hemp has emerged as a source of non-hallucinogenic therapeutic phytocannabinoids (e.g., CBD) with distinct properties from marijuana, although historically a fiber and grain crop. To treat different medical conditions, dozens of clinical trials are now exploring anecdotal applications of CBD.

MARKET RESTRAINTS:

However, it is projected that the complex regulatory framework for the use of industrial hemp in various countries will impede the growth of industrial hemp in the market.  In the U.S. hemp industry, there are three main federal regulatory agencies involved: the U.S. The Department of Agriculture (USDA), the Administration of Food and Drugs (FDA), and the Agency for Environmental Protection (EPA). None of these organizations have released hemp industry regulations to date. The growth of the industry remains limited as a result. Although there is a rise in demand for hemp products in the United States, many people still negatively view hemp. Many customers, regulators, and law enforcement officials also claim that cannabis is the same or somewhat similar to cannabis. Many of the challenges in the hemp industry today go back to the lack of hemp-related legislation and the misperceptions surrounding it, and this includes financial barriers faced by hemp businesses. These are the restricting factors for the industrial hemp market.

Hemp is an extremely diverse crop that can contribute to the markets for seed/oil, fiber, and medicinal products. The global demand for hemp-based products is projected to double by 2021, mainly due to growth in the US market. The hemp industry is growing rapidly, but as long as regulations are unclear and misperceptions exist, the industry and the companies working within it will not have the ability to expand to their fullest potential. Through conventional plant breeding, many essential crop improvements can be achieved. However, studies to elucidate the underlying biology of the development of hemp seeds, fiber, and metabolites are lacking. In the food supply chains, hemp remains a niche crop, making it prohibitively costly as a feedstock in biodiesel manufacture. The cost of producing hemp oil and consequently hemp biodiesel could be improved by legalization and increased hemp oil production.
